Bill Kelly

William N. Kelly is an award-winning landscape painter who is known for his watercolors of mountains, forests, and other natural landscapes. 

His work is characterized by its loose, painterly brushwork and its use of light and shadow to create a sense of atmosphere.

Kelly was born in Midland, Michigan.  He began painting at a young age, and he developed a passion for watercolors while in High School. After attending Michigan State University, and studying Advertising and Communication Arts, Kelly moved to Colorado, He has mostly lived and worked in Colorado ever since.

Kelly's paintings have been exhibited at shows in the Aspen Chapel Gallery, The Western Colorado Watercolor Society, The Rockies West National Show, The Brush and Palette Club, The Edge of Cedars Show, The Garfield County Fair and the Glenwood Library. His paintings are in the collections of many private individuals.

Kelly is an enthusiastic painter who is constantly experimenting with new techniques and styles.  He is inspired by the beauty of the natural world and he strives to capture the essence of nature in his paintings.
